Arne Næss was a Norwegian philosopher and the founder of the deep ecology movement, playing an important role in connecting philosophy with environmental issues. By criticizing anthropocentrism, he emphasized the intrinsic value of all living beings and the need to transform humanity’s relationship with nature.
